175 WWUS84 KTSA 230358 SPSTSA Special Weather Statement National Weather Service Tulsa OK 1058 PM CDT Wed May 22 2024 OKZ049-053-230430- Choctaw OK-Pushmataha OK- 1058 PM CDT Wed May 22 2024 ...A STRONG THUNDERSTORM WILL IMPACT SOUTHWESTERN PUSHMATAHA AND NORTHWESTERN CHOCTAW COUNTIES THROUGH 1130 PM CDT... At 1057 PM CDT, Doppler radar indicated a strong thunderstorm 7 miles northeast of Bennington, moving northeast at 30 mph. HAZARD...Wind gusts up to 40 mph and penny size hail. SOURCE...Radar indicated. IMPACT...Gusty winds could knock down small tree limbs and blow around unsecured objects. Minor hail damage to vegetation is possible. Locations in or near the path include... Darwin... P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S...
